The Georgian Chemical Industry: Growth, Regulation, and Opportunity
The chemical industry in Georgia (the country) is a sector undergoing development and modernization, primarily driven by domestic demand in key areas such as agriculture, industrial inputs, and consumer goods. While its scale may differ from larger, more established chemical economies, its strategic importance to Georgia’s self-sufficiency and economic growth is undeniable. Key segments within the Georgian chemical sector, or those that necessitate chemical processing, typically include:
Agricultural Chemicals: This is a prominent area, driven by Georgia's significant agricultural sector. It includes the production, import, and distribution of pesticides, herbicides, and fertilizers, vital for crop yield and food security.
Basic Industrial Chemicals: While perhaps smaller in scale, there is a need for the production and handling of foundational chemical compounds, including acids, alkalis, and various inorganic chemicals used across other manufacturing industries.
Petroleum Products and Derivatives: Given Georgia’s role as a transit corridor and its energy needs, there are requirements for the processing, storage, and distribution of petroleum-related chemicals and refined products.
Household and Cleaning Chemicals: Production of disinfectants, detergents, and other chemical preparations for domestic and commercial use.
Water Treatment Chemicals: As industrial processes expand, the need for effective water and wastewater treatment grows, requiring chemicals for purification and discharge compliance.
Georgia's commitment to aligning with international standards, particularly as it strengthens ties with the European Union, significantly influences its industrial regulatory landscape. The chemical sector operates under a framework designed to ensure safety, environmental protection, and responsible management of hazardous substances. Key regulations and initiatives include:
The Law of Georgia On Hazardous Chemical Substances (2007): This foundational law regulates the entire lifecycle of hazardous chemicals, from production, import, and export to transportation, storage, use, and processing. Its objective is to prevent harmful effects on human health and the environment, introducing principles for safe use and classification of chemicals. This legislative emphasis directly mandates the use of safe and reliable containment solutions.
The Waste Management Code of Georgia: This code classifies chemical residues and containers, such as empty pesticide containers, as hazardous waste, requiring proper management plans for industrial and agricultural entities. This highlights the need for vessels that facilitate efficient cleaning and minimize hazardous waste generation.
Alignment with International Conventions: Georgia is actively working to harmonize its national legislation with international multilateral environmental agreements, such as the Basel, Rotterdam, and Stockholm conventions, focusing on improved management of hazardous chemicals and waste. This commitment to international best practices drives the demand for modern, compliant industrial equipment.
Technical Regulations for Pressure Equipment: Crucially for Center Enamel, Georgia has adopted technical regulations for pressure equipment that apply to the design, manufacture, and conformity assessment of pressure equipment and assemblies with a maximum allowable pressure exceeding 0.5 bar. These regulations define "vessels" and "safety components" and outline strict compliance requirements, mirroring the comprehensive approach of European standards like the Pressure Equipment Directive (PED). This signifies a clear legal mandate for high-quality, certified pressure vessels.
